Illinois, a state characterized by its continental climate, presents distinct seasonal demands for accommodation providers. The major metropolitan areas of Chicago, Joliet, and Elgin experience humid summers and frigid winters, influencing both occupancy rates and the operational considerations for lodging facilities.

The varied climate across Illinois, from the lake-effect snow in the north to the more temperate southern regions, mandates adaptable operational strategies for hotels. Summer months, particularly in Chicago, see a surge in tourism and corporate travel, while winter necessitates robust heating systems and preparedness for weather-related travel disruptions. Permitting and licensing are generally managed at the municipal level, with Chicago having particularly stringent zoning and health code requirements that all establishments must adhere to, impacting everything from fire suppression systems to waste management protocols. Understanding these localized regulations is paramount for ensuring compliance and operational continuity.

Can you live in a motel and pay monthly in Illinois?

In certain Illinois municipalities, extended-stay motels may offer monthly payment options for longer-term accommodations. These arrangements are typically subject to specific occupancy agreements and may require adherence to local residential housing standards, which can vary significantly between cities like Chicago and smaller towns.

Where to stay when you can't afford a hotel in Illinois?

When hotel rates in Illinois are prohibitive, exploring options like shared housing platforms or budget-friendly hostels in metropolitan areas such as Chicago can be viable. Some extended-stay facilities also provide more economical weekly rates that can approximate monthly living expenses.

How to get 50% off on hotel bookings in Illinois?

Achieving significant discounts on hotel bookings in Illinois often involves leveraging loyalty programs, booking during off-peak seasons, or utilizing last-minute deal aggregators. Strategic timing and flexibility with dates, particularly outside of major events in Chicago, can yield substantial savings.

How to get the lowest rate at a hotel in Illinois?

To secure the lowest rate at an Illinois hotel, consider booking directly through the hotel's official website, as they sometimes offer exclusive discounts. Comparing rates across multiple booking platforms and inquiring about any available corporate or AAA rates can also lead to a more favorable price.

Where do you find the cheapest hotel deals in Illinois?

The most economical hotel deals in Illinois are often discovered through online travel agencies, flash sale websites, and by monitoring hotel promotions during shoulder seasons. Cities like Joliet and Elgin may present more budget-friendly options compared to Chicago's prime locations.
